Under Sink Water Extraction Cost In Conroe, TX

The cost of Under Sink Water Extraction in Conroe,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Cleanup and disinfection $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Equipment rental $100 – $500 Duration of rental, equipment type, and local conditions.

Q: How long does it take to dry out my home?

A: The time it takes to dry out your home dep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team can typically dry out a home in 3-5 days, but it may take longer for more extensive damage. We’ll get the job done as quickly as possible. We’ll keep you updated on our progress.
